The Human Hyena (1995)

The Human Hyena (1995) poster

The dead body of a young man who was kidnapped is found, the police looks for the kidnappers as a web of corruption its uncovered in the police department.

Director: Ismael Rodríguez Jr.
Genre: Action, Crime, Drama
Runtime: 82 min
